Visual Studio 2005下创建的ASP.NET基础表单

需积分: 9 3 下载量 87 浏览量 更新于2024-09-17 收藏 6KB TXT 举报
ASP.NET 简单页面是一种基于微软Visual Studio 2005环境构建的Web应用程序,它使用服务器端脚本语言如VBScript来动态生成HTML内容。在这个示例中,我们看到一个名为"2000081402"的网页,其核心功能是处理用户提交的信息并展示在页面上。 首先,页面的开始部分使用了ASP.NET指令`<%@Language=VBScript%>`,这表示后续的脚本将使用VBScript进行编写。`<html>`标签标志着HTML文档的开始,`<head>`包含页面元数据,如标题`<title>2000081402</title>`,定义了浏览器标签页的标题。 在`<body>`部分,我们看到了一个表单`<form id="sample1" method="post" action="sample1.asp">`,它使用POST方法提交数据到同一目录下的"sample1.asp"文件。这里的关键在于`If Request.Form.Count <> 0 Then`这段代码,它检查是否有表单数据被提交。如果有,会显示用户的姓名和他们选择的颜色。 接下来,代码通过`Response.Write`语句显示用户输入的名字和选择的颜色,如果表单字段为空,则不会显示任何内容。`Request.Form("txtName")`获取文本框`txtName`中的值,`Request.Form("selColor")`获取下拉列表`selColor`中的选中项。 表单本身包含两个字段:`<input type="text" name="txtName" value="<%=Request.Form("txtName")%>">`用于输入用户姓名,其初始值设置为用户提交的值;`<select name="selColor">`是一个下拉列表,提供了几种颜色供用户选择,并通过条件语句`<%if ... %> ... <%end if%>`为已选择的颜色添加了`selected`属性。 总结来说,这个ASP.NET简单页面展示了如何使用VBScript处理用户输入,包括表单验证、数据获取以及动态生成HTML内容。这是一个基础的服务器端脚本交互示例,对于初学者了解ASP.NET编程结构和表单处理非常有帮助。